Breathitt County, Kentucky Electricity Overview

The electricity consumed by consumers in Breathitt County is produced outside of their borders as the county has no power generation facilities.

During the course of the most recent year, Breathitt County experienced a 2.47% rise in CO2 emissions per capita.

With a population of 13,652 residents, Breathitt County is the 2261st largest county by population in the US.

With a nationwide average residential electric bill of $147.16, Breathitt County residents pay about 19.43% more than their fellow Americans per month for electricity.

Breathitt County ranks 81st out of 120 counties in the state for total electricity consumption, with its population consuming over 200,000 megawatt hours.

Breathitt County released 178,359,119.3 kilograms of CO2 gases from electricity use, which ranks it as the 1289th highest polluting county in the nation.

Jackson, KY Electricity Overview

Coverage Map Placeholder

On average, Jackson's inhabitants purchase residential electricity for 14.81 cents per kilowatt hour, which is 12.66% more than the average state rate of 13.14 cents. Customers in the city are faced with 1.67 electrical outages per year, with outages lasting about 291.81 minutes on average. The national averages for outages and duration are 1.44 outages at 123.49 minutes each. The largest electricity supplier in the city based on megawatt hours sold is Kentucky Power.

Roughly 30,205,558.44 kilograms of CO2 emissions are released a year in Jackson because of electricity use. More importantly, the city averages 13,064.69 kilograms of CO2 emissions per citizen, which is a better measurement of the city's pollution levels. The electricity used in Jackson has to be imported from surrounding cities and rural areas, since there are no power generation sources in the city.

Breathitt County, Kentucky Net Metering

Breathitt County has 1 out of 2 companies reporting that they offer net metering to residents with personal solar panels. Kentucky has heavily restricted regulations in place for consumers who are interested in taking advantage of net metering with solar panels.

Energy Loss

Breathitt County has an average of 4.54% of the energy that is transmitted in the state dissipated as heat. The nationwide average for energy loss is 2.43% and the state average is 3.30%, resulting in a rank of 1593rd best in the US and a state rank of 76th best out of 3221 and 120 counties, respectively.
